Ireland’s aerospace and aviation sector contributes approximately €4.6bn to the economy and supports around 44,000 jobs nationwide. The figures were revealed at an Enterprise Ireland trade mission to the Farnborough International Airshow. The industry spans aircraft leasing, maintenance, advanced manufacturing, drones, emerging air mobility and space-related innovation, reinforcing Ireland’s global reputation in aviation finance and related activities.

The sector’s contribution underscores Ireland’s position as a leading global hub for aviation finance. The aircraft leasing industry, in particular, has been a significant driver of growth, with major lessors maintaining substantial operations in Dublin. The Enterprise Ireland trade mission to Farnborough provided an opportunity to showcase Irish capabilities in advanced manufacturing, drones and emerging air mobility technologies. Space-related innovation is also emerging as a growing area of activity within the sector.

The figures represent a significant contribution to the Irish economy. The sector’s continued growth is supported by Ireland’s favourable regulatory environment and skilled workforce. Enterprise Ireland has not released a breakdown of the jobs by specific subsector. The trade mission to Farnborough highlighted Ireland’s commitment to maintaining its leadership position in the global aviation and aerospace industries.
